Embedding Video in Video

Ok, I must admit that this technology developed by some Stanfurd guys is very cool.  Their examples for using this technology are mainly advertisement embedding, but I think that ads are just the beginning.  The ability to detect near/far objects in a 2D, moving image, and to do so cheaply, is a major milestone for independent videos.  Just couple this idea with cheap, 3D rendering software and I’m sure some film student could make a movie to rival Star Wars Episode 3.  (Hmmm… I guess a kindergartner with crayons and scotch tape could make a better movie than Star Wars Episode 3, but that’s not my point.)
